Comprehending Vision Modification Options



Are you asking yourself if Lasik eye surgery is the appropriate option for you and your vision adjustment requirements? Understanding the various vision adjustment choices offered can aid you make an informed decision.



Lasik is a prominent procedure that can deal with nearsightedness, farsightedness, and astigmatism. It includes improving the cornea making use of a laser, which aids enhance your vision.

Lasik is a quick and relatively painless treatment, with the majority of individuals experiencing improved vision within a couple of days. However, it is very important to note that not everybody is an ideal candidate for Lasik. Elements such as age, eye health and wellness, and prescription stability contribute in establishing qualification.

To discover if Lasik is right for you, speak with a certified eye cosmetic surgeon that can examine your individual needs and give tailored referrals.

Figuring Out Qualification for LASIK



To identify your qualification for LASIK, it is very important to evaluate your way of life and day-to-day tasks to see if they straighten with the demands for going through the procedure. LASIK is not suitable for every person, so it is crucial to establish if you satisfy the qualification requirements.

First of all, you need to have a steady prescription for at the very least one year. Varying vision can affect the accuracy of the surgical procedure. In addition, you must be at the very least 18 years of ages, as your eyes are still establishing before this age.

Other factors to consider include having healthy and balanced eyes with no background of eye conditions or conditions like glaucoma or cataracts. It is also important to have reasonable expectations and understand that LASIK may not completely eliminate your need for glasses or calls.

Consulting with an experienced LASIK cosmetic surgeon will assist establish if you are a great candidate for this procedure.
